This old swing set was here when I move in five years ago.  Initially I wanted to take it out but it's set in concrete and I know my limitations so it just sat there looking forlorn and out of place for two years.  Then I decided to plant a rose bush underneath because I wanted roses and didn't have enough room for many.  I detached the swings and used the hooks for hanging baskets.

It finally dawned on me that I had a ready made arbor so my dad nailed some boards to the sides so I could grow the Clematis that I love.  One day after fruitlessly searching for a reasonably priced birdbath I found this  concrete one on ebay for only $9 and it was a local pickup.  I had to roll it in two sections to the back yard but I just love it.  One of a kind.

 

It now has 3 rose bushes, 2 blazing stars, 4 clematis, 2 hollyhocks, 1 phlox, 1 daylily and a wintersown nicotiana.  It's amazing how many plants a determined gardener can pack into a small place.
